
Soviet Union 1927 Speaker Haranguing Mob with Fake Overprint
Soviet Union · 1927 · 10 kopecks
The stamp depicts a speaker on a platform addressing a crowd, with the denomination '10 kopecks' at the bottom. It features a red overprint.
Issued in 1927, this stamp is part of the early definitive issues of the Soviet Union, reflecting revolutionary and socialist themes prevalent after the October Revolution. The specific item features a fake overprint, indicating a later attempt to create a philatelic rarity.
